Does Brazil give the right to time off on game days?
According to Labor Laws, departure days from Brazil are not considered national or religious holidays. Therefore, contractors are not required by law to interrupt activities.
Article 70 of the law states that: "Except for the provisions of articles 68 and 69, work on national holidays and religious holidays is prohibited, in accordance with specific legislation."
However, this also does not prevent them from giving the team's match days as a day off for their workers, or interrupting activities during the 90 minutes of the match.
